84.33 percent of the population in 48310 drive to work alone. 0.59 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 65.19 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.60 percent of the residents in 48310 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.88 members with about 2.18 cars available per household.
An estimate of 91.23 percent of the residents in 48310 has some form of health insurance. 47.37 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 57.08 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 48310 would have to travel an average of 9.03 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Ascension Providence Rochester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 48310, Sterling Heights, Michigan.

As of , an estimate of 43,963 residents live in 48310 with a median age of 38.8 years. 21.65 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.25 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.65 percent of the residents in 48310 is currently married, and 20.36 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 48310 is $6,182.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 48310 is approximately $1,116. The median household spends about 18.05 percent of their income on housing.
